/*
* Asterisk -- An open source telephony toolkit.
*
* Copyright (C) 1999 - 2005, Digium, Inc.
*
* Mark Spencer <markster@digium.com>
*
* See http://www.asterisk.org for more information about
* the Asterisk project. Please do not directly contact
* any of the maintainers of this project for assistance;
* the project provides a web site, mailing lists and IRC
* channels for your use.
*
* This program is free software, distributed under the terms of
* the GNU General Public License Version 2. See the LICENSE file
* at the top of the source tree.
*/
/*! \file
*
* \brief Trivial application to read a variable
*
* \author Mark Spencer <markster@digium.com>
*
* \ingroup applications
*/
#include "asterisk.h"
ASTERISK_FILE_VERSION(__FILE__, "$Revision$")
#include "asterisk/lock.h"
#include "asterisk/file.h"
#include "asterisk/logger.h"
#include "asterisk/channel.h"
#include "asterisk/pbx.h"
#include "asterisk/app.h"
#include "asterisk/module.h"
#include "asterisk/translate.h"
#include "asterisk/options.h"
#include "asterisk/utils.h"
#include "asterisk/indications.h"
enum {
OPT_SKIP = (1 << 0),
OPT_INDICATION = (1 << 1),
OPT_NOANSWER = (1 << 2),
} read_option_flags;
AST_APP_OPTIONS(read_app_options, {
AST_APP_OPTION('s', OPT_SKIP),
AST_APP_OPTION('i', OPT_INDICATION),
AST_APP_OPTION('n', OPT_NOANSWER),
});
static char *app = "Read";
static char *synopsis = "Read a variable";
static char *descrip =
" Read(variable[,filename[&filename2...]][,maxdigits][,option][,attempts][,timeout])\n\n"
"Reads a #-terminated string of digits a certain number of times from the\n"
"user in to the given variable.\n"
" filename -- file(s) to play before reading digits or tone with option i\n"
" maxdigits -- maximum acceptable number of digits. Stops reading after\n"
" maxdigits have been entered (without requiring the user to\n"
" press the '#' key).\n"
" Defaults to 0 - no limit - wait for the user press the '#' key.\n"
" Any value below 0 means the same. Max accepted value is 255.\n"
" option -- options are 's' , 'i', 'n'\n"
" 's' to return immediately if the line is not up,\n"
" 'i' to play filename as an indication tone from your indications.conf\n"
" 'n' to read digits even if the line is not up.\n"
" attempts -- if greater than 1, that many attempts will be made in the \n"
" event no data is entered.\n"
" timeout -- The number of seconds to wait for a digit response. If greater\n"
" than 0, that value will override the default timeout. Can be floating point.\n\n"
"Read should disconnect if the function fails or errors out.\n";
#define ast_next_data(instr,ptr,delim) if((ptr=strchr(instr,delim))) { *(ptr) = '\0' ; ptr++;}
static int read_exec(struct ast_channel *chan, void *data)
{
int res = 0;
char tmp[256] = "";
int maxdigits = 255;
int tries = 1, to = 0, x = 0;
double tosec;
char *argcopy = NULL;
struct ind_tone_zone_sound *ts;
struct ast_flags flags = {0};
AST_DECLARE_APP_ARGS(arglist,
AST_APP_ARG(variable);
AST_APP_ARG(filename);
AST_APP_ARG(maxdigits);
AST_APP_ARG(options);
AST_APP_ARG(attempts);
AST_APP_ARG(timeout);
);
if (ast_strlen_zero(data)) {
ast_log(LOG_WARNING, "Read requires an argument (variable)\n");
return -1;
}
argcopy = ast_strdupa(data);
AST_STANDARD_APP_ARGS(arglist, argcopy);
if (!ast_strlen_zero(arglist.options)) {
ast_app_parse_options(read_app_options, &flags, NULL, arglist.options);
}
if (!ast_strlen_zero(arglist.attempts)) {
tries = atoi(arglist.attempts);
if (tries <= 0)
tries = 1;
}
if (!ast_strlen_zero(arglist.timeout)) {
tosec = atof(arglist.timeout);
if (tosec <= 0)
to = 0;
else {
to = tosec * 1000.0;
if (to <= 0) {
/* Make sure we don't use the default timeout. */
ast_log(LOG_WARNING, "Read timeout less than 1 ms, assuming 1 ms timeout\n");
to = 1;
}
}
}
if (ast_strlen_zero(arglist.filename)) {
arglist.filename = NULL;
}
if (!ast_strlen_zero(arglist.maxdigits)) {
maxdigits = atoi(arglist.maxdigits);
if ((maxdigits<1) || (maxdigits>255)) {
maxdigits = 255;
} else
ast_verb(3, "Accepting a maximum of %d digits.\n", maxdigits);
}
if (ast_strlen_zero(arglist.variable)) {
ast_log(LOG_WARNING, "Invalid! Usage: Read(variable[,filename][,maxdigits][,option][,attempts][,timeout])\n\n");
return -1;
}
ts=NULL;
if (ast_test_flag(&flags,OPT_INDICATION)) {
if (!ast_strlen_zero(arglist.filename)) {
ts = ast_get_indication_tone(chan->zone,arglist.filename);
}
}
if (chan->_state != AST_STATE_UP) {
if (ast_test_flag(&flags,OPT_SKIP)) {
/* At the user's option, skip if the line is not up */
pbx_builtin_setvar_helper(chan, arglist.variable, "\0");
return 0;
} else if (!ast_test_flag(&flags,OPT_NOANSWER)) {
/* Otherwise answer unless we're supposed to read while on-hook */
res = ast_answer(chan);
}
}
if (!res) {
while (tries && !res) {
ast_stopstream(chan);
if (ts && ts->data[0]) {
if (!to)
to = chan->pbx ? chan->pbx->rtimeout * 1000 : 6000;
res = ast_playtones_start(chan, 0, ts->data, 0);
for (x = 0; x < maxdigits; ) {
res = ast_waitfordigit(chan, to);
ast_playtones_stop(chan);
if (res < 1) {
tmp[x]='\0';
break;
}
tmp[x++] = res;
if (tmp[x-1] == '#') {
tmp[x-1] = '\0';
break;
}
}
} else {
res = ast_app_getdata(chan, arglist.filename, tmp, maxdigits, to);
}
if (res > -1) {
pbx_builtin_setvar_helper(chan, arglist.variable, tmp);
if (!ast_strlen_zero(tmp)) {
ast_verb(3, "User entered '%s'\n", tmp);
tries = 0;
} else {
tries--;
if (tries)
ast_verb(3, "User entered nothing, %d chance%s left\n", tries, (tries != 1) ? "s" : "");
else
ast_verb(3, "User entered nothing.\n");
}
res = 0;
} else {
pbx_builtin_setvar_helper(chan, arglist.variable, tmp);
ast_verb(3, "User disconnected\n");
}
}
}
return res;
}
static int unload_module(void)
{
return ast_unregister_application(app);
}
static int load_module(void)
{
return ast_register_application(app, read_exec, synopsis, descrip);
}
AST_MODULE_INFO_STANDARD(ASTERISK_GPL_KEY, "Read Variable Application");
